Output 24c63e6075543166810879747894881b4962639f14a1a3b9398c7e69aeb64530:8

value
145405
script pubkey
OP_0 OP_PUSHBYTES_20 29e26ce09943ecc80413151e6ddb7e3283a5ace3
address
bc1q983xecyeg0kvspqnz50xmkm7x2p6tt8r7q5pk9
transaction
24c63e6075543166810879747894881b4962639f14a1a3b9398c7e69aeb64530